What Factors Should You Consider When Choosing Kitchen Cabinets in Ramsey NJ?

When choosing kitchen cabinets in Ramsey, NJ, several important factors should be considered to ensure a perfect fit for your space and lifestyle.

  • Material: The material of the cabinets affects both durability and appearance. Options like hardwood, plywood, and MDF offer various strengths and finishes, with hardwood being the most durable and aesthetically pleasing, while MDF is more budget-friendly but less durable.
  • Style: The style of the cabinets should complement your kitchen’s overall design. Whether you prefer traditional, contemporary, or farmhouse styles, the cabinet design will influence the kitchen’s ambiance and functionality.
  • Storage Needs: Assessing your storage requirements is crucial. Consider how many items you need to store and what type of organization (like pull-out shelves or lazy Susans) will best meet your needs, as effective storage maximizes space utilization.
  • Finish: The finish of the cabinets impacts both aesthetics and maintenance. Popular finishes include painted, stained, or natural wood, each offering different looks and levels of upkeep, with lighter finishes often making spaces feel larger.
  • Budget: Setting a budget is essential as it helps narrow down options. Kitchen cabinets can vary widely in price, so understanding your financial limits will guide you to the best choices that fit your design and quality requirements.
  • Functionality: Consider how you use your kitchen daily. Cabinets that offer easy access and convenience, such as soft-close doors and drawers, can enhance the overall user experience and improve workflow in the kitchen.
  • Installation: The complexity of installation can influence your choice. Some cabinets come ready to install, while others may require professional help, which adds to the overall cost and timeline of your kitchen renovation.

What Popular Styles of Kitchen Cabinets Are Found in Ramsey NJ?

In Ramsey, NJ, popular styles of kitchen cabinets include:

  • Shaker Style: Shaker cabinets are characterized by their clean lines and simple design, making them a versatile choice for various kitchen styles. They usually feature a recessed panel and can be finished in an array of colors, offering both modern and traditional aesthetics.
  • Modern Flat-Panel: These cabinets have a sleek, minimalist look with a flat surface and no embellishments, appealing to contemporary design lovers. They often utilize high-gloss finishes or natural wood veneers, providing a sophisticated and streamlined appearance.
  • Raised Panel: Raised panel cabinets have a three-dimensional design with a prominent central panel, adding depth and elegance to traditional kitchens. This style often showcases intricate detailing and is commonly available in rich, dark woods, which can enhance the warmth of a classic kitchen space.
  • Cottage Style: Cottage cabinets evoke a cozy and inviting atmosphere with their soft colors and distressed finishes. This style often incorporates beadboard elements and decorative hardware, making it a popular choice for those looking to create a charming, farmhouse-inspired kitchen.
  • Glass-Front Cabinets: Glass-front cabinets are ideal for displaying fine china or decorative items, adding an airy feel to kitchen spaces. These cabinets can be combined with various styles, from modern to traditional, and often come with lighting options to enhance the showcased items.

How Do Traditional and Modern Cabinet Styles Differ in Ramsey NJ?

Traditional and modern cabinet styles present distinct characteristics and designs that cater to different aesthetic preferences in Ramsey, NJ.

  • Traditional Cabinets: These cabinets are characterized by ornate details, rich wood finishes, and classic designs.
  • Modern Cabinets: Modern cabinets feature sleek lines, minimal ornamentation, and often utilize materials like laminate or glass for a contemporary look.
  • Color Palette: Traditional cabinets often use warm, earthy tones, while modern cabinets lean towards bold or neutral colors.
  • Hardware: Traditional styles typically incorporate antique or decorative hardware, whereas modern cabinets favor simple, streamlined handles.

Traditional cabinets are often made from solid woods like oak or cherry and may include features such as raised panel doors and intricate moldings. These designs evoke a sense of craftsmanship and historical influence, appealing to those who appreciate timeless elegance.

Modern cabinets, in contrast, prioritize functionality and simplicity, often incorporating handle-less designs and flat surfaces. They are designed to create a clean, uncluttered look, making them ideal for contemporary kitchen spaces that emphasize efficiency and style.

The color palette for traditional cabinets often consists of warm, rich shades, such as deep browns and creams, which help create a cozy and inviting atmosphere. This contrasts with modern cabinets, which may use a mix of bold colors or neutral tones like white, gray, or black to enhance a sleek and sophisticated environment.

In terms of hardware, traditional cabinets often feature ornate knobs and pulls made from brass or wrought iron, contributing to their vintage aesthetic. On the other hand, modern cabinets tend to use minimalist hardware or none at all, reinforcing their streamlined appearance and focus on clean lines.

Which Materials Are Most Recommended for Kitchen Cabinets in Ramsey NJ?

The best materials for kitchen cabinets in Ramsey, NJ, include a variety of options that combine durability, aesthetics, and functionality.

  • Solid Wood: Solid wood is a top choice for kitchen cabinets due to its natural beauty and strength.
  • Particleboard: Particleboard is an economical option that is often used in budget-friendly cabinet designs.
  • Plywood: Plywood offers a balance between affordability and quality, making it a popular choice for many homeowners.
  • MDF (Medium Density Fiberboard): MDF is a versatile material that is smooth and ideal for painted finishes.
  • Metal: Metal cabinets are gaining popularity for their modern aesthetic and durability, particularly in contemporary kitchen designs.

Solid Wood: Solid wood cabinets provide a timeless appeal and are available in various species, including oak, maple, and cherry. They are known for their longevity and can be refinished if they wear over time, making them a great investment for your kitchen.

Particleboard: Made from wood chips and adhesive, particleboard is cost-effective and can be covered with laminate or veneer for a more attractive finish. While less durable than solid wood, it can be a suitable option for those seeking budget-friendly cabinets.

Plywood: Plywood consists of layers of wood veneer glued together, giving it strength and resistance to warping. It is often used in higher-quality cabinet constructions and provides a good balance of price and performance.

MDF (Medium Density Fiberboard): MDF is engineered from wood fibers and resin, resulting in a dense and smooth surface that is perfect for painting. Its uniform texture allows for intricate designs and is less likely to crack or warp compared to solid wood.

Metal: Metal cabinets, often made from stainless steel or aluminum, are known for their sleek, industrial look and exceptional durability. They are resistant to moisture and easy to clean, making them ideal for modern kitchens that prioritize functionality along with style.

What Are the Pros and Cons of Solid Wood vs. Engineered Options for Cabinets?

Feature Solid Wood Engineered Wood
Durability Highly durable and can last for decades with proper care. Less durable, may not withstand heavy wear as well as solid wood.
Cost Generally more expensive due to the quality of materials. More affordable, making it a budget-friendly option.
Aesthetics Offers a classic, natural look with unique grain patterns. Can mimic the look of solid wood, but may lack individuality.
Environmental Impact Harvesting can be unsustainable if not managed properly. Often made from recycled materials, which can be more eco-friendly.
Weight and Installation Heavier and may require more effort to install. Lighter and generally easier to install.
Moisture Resistance More susceptible to warping and damage in humid environments. Better moisture resistance, making it suitable for kitchens.
Maintenance Requirements Requires regular polishing and care to maintain appearance. Lower maintenance, often needs just cleaning with mild soap.
Customization Options Can be custom-made to fit specific designs and styles. Limited customization, usually available in standard sizes and finishes.
